Have you ever wondered why, despite all our modern comforts, so many of us still struggle with unhappiness and anxiety? What if a more fulfilling life isn't about constant positivity but rather a form of ‘cheerful pessimism’?

Today's guest is Alain de Botton. Alain is the founder of The School of Life, a hugely popular education and wellness organisation that provides guidance on how to achieve happiness and fulfilment. He is also an internationally renowned philosopher and the author of multiple books including his very latest: A Therapeutic Journey: Lessons From The School of Life

In this conversation, we delve deep into the complexities of modern life and the importance of love, empathy and tolerance in addressing societal problems. Alain introduces the concept of ‘attuned care’ in childhood and explains why a lack of it can show up in our adult behaviours and relationships.

Alain also explains a concept that he calls ‘cheerful pessimism’ which challenges what he describes as the modern obsession with happiness and introduces the idea that a more melancholic outlook to life, might actually lead to greater fulfilment.

We also discuss the value of inner reflection, the truth about modern anxiety and the importance of effective communication. Throughout this conversation, Alain shares practical tools that we can immediately apply into our lives – such as specific journaling exercises, ‘the 2 chair’ technique he has borrowed from Gestalt therapy and simple strategies to help us become better listeners and more effective communicators.

Mindsip insights from this episode:

Utilize two-chair exercise for emotional calm

The 'two-chair exercise' from Gestalt therapy, where you speak to an empty chair as if it's a person you need to talk to, can bring enormous calm by letting you have your say.

Reconcile perfectionism with acceptance of human fallibility

Runaway perfectionism is a natural consequence of living in a world where we are daily reminded of extraordinary human achievements, making it hard to reconcile with our own folly.

Build habits and rituals to conquer willpower challenges

To overcome the weakness of will, we need to construct habits and rituals, because our emotions are governed by habits, not by information.

Limit freedom to enhance decision-making clarity

Contrary to modern ideals, increasing individual freedom beyond a certain point does not lead to better choices and can become paralyzing.

Find solace in nature's grandeur to embrace insignificance

We are longing to be made to feel small and insignificant by something grand like nature, as it's a delightful relief from our constant, foiled desire for significance.

Compartmentalize worries for a healthier mind

A key feature of a healthy mind is the ability to compartmentalize, which is the capacity to prevent one worry from cascading through and infecting every area of life.

Recognize anger as a reflection of unmet optimism

According to Stoic philosophy, behind every angry outburst lies a 'demented optimist,' as anger stems from our optimistic expectations being violated by reality.

Premeditate worst possibilities to cultivate calm and gratitude

The Stoic practice of premeditating the day's worst possibilities can lead to calm and gratitude by widening our sense of what could happen.

Ask your date how you are crazy to embrace imperfections

A useful question for a new couple is 'How are you crazy?' because acknowledging our varied imperfections is vital for accommodating ourselves to reality.

Recognize love as essential for healthy development

The inventor of attachment theory, John Bowlby, argued that love is as essential as vitamins for healthy human development.
